As the release date approaches, WoW players are eager to see how this update compares to its original iteration from 2011. The introduction of new content, particularly the Rage of the Firelands raid, is expected to revitalize the gaming experience. Raiding guilds will have the opportunity to tackle the challenges posed by Ragnaros and his lieutenants shortly after the update goes live.
The Rage of the Firelands update is viewed as the second-to-last chapter in the ambitious roadmap for Cataclysm Classic. Followingly, the final major update, Hour of Twilight, is tentatively planned for January 2025. This timeline suggests that players will have ample content to explore during the remaining months of 2024.
